#33707e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33707e is composed of 20% red, 43.9%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 191.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 34.7%. #33707e color hex could be obtained by blending #66e0f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#33707e color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#33707e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33707e has RGB values of R:51, G:112,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3371134.

Shades and Tints of #33707e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#33707e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555b5c is the less saturated color, while #038eae is the most saturated one.
